1324714Scy/*
2324714Scy * libwpa_test - Test program for libwpa_client.* library linking
3324714Scy * Copyright (c) 2015, Jouni Malinen <j@w1.fi>
4324714Scy *
5324714Scy * This software may be distributed under the terms of the BSD license.
6324714Scy * See README for more details.
7324714Scy */
8324714Scy
9324714Scy#include "includes.h"
10324714Scy
11324714Scy#include "common/wpa_ctrl.h"
12324714Scy
13324714Scyint main(int argc, char *argv[])
14324714Scy{
15324714Scy	struct wpa_ctrl *ctrl;
16324714Scy
17324714Scy	ctrl = wpa_ctrl_open("foo");
18324714Scy	if (!ctrl)
19324714Scy		return -1;
20324714Scy	if (wpa_ctrl_attach(ctrl) == 0)
21324714Scy		wpa_ctrl_detach(ctrl);
22324714Scy	if (wpa_ctrl_pending(ctrl)) {
23324714Scy		char buf[10];
24324714Scy		size_t len;
25324714Scy
26324714Scy		len = sizeof(buf);
27324714Scy		wpa_ctrl_recv(ctrl, buf, &len);
28324714Scy	}
29324714Scy	wpa_ctrl_close(ctrl);
30324714Scy
31324714Scy	return 0;
32324714Scy}
33